Modes of operation

To choose the right charger for your battery, at the beginning of the article we talked about figuring out the type of battery. For the most common WET models, all devices are suitable, but for AGM and GEL. But in advanced models, there should be special modes for charging. These batteries are very sensitive to overcharging voltage. If for WET batteries the voltage of 15 volts is not critical, then for gel batteries it can lead to irreversible changes. From the increased voltage, the gel or fiberglass will begin to peel off from the plates and the battery will lose its characteristics. In the worst case, the battery will swell and fail.


Pay attention to the presence of the Boost mode. It is designed for fast charging of the battery with increased current. Thanks to this mode, you can make the necessary charging and in 20 minutes.

Voltage supplied by the charger

The voltage that the charger gives out must correspond to the nominal voltage of the battery, which you should have found out before choosing. Almost all modern car battery chargers supply 12 volts. The second most popular charger with the ability to charge a battery with a nominal value of 24 volts. Less common are chargers that deliver 6 volts. This mode is useful when charging appropriate batteries for motorcycles, scooters, etc. Ideally, the charger should be able to manually set the voltage, but such models are rare.

Charging current

In order to choose the right charger for this parameter, at the beginning of the article we found out the nominal capacity of the battery. The charging current should not exceed 10 percent of the battery capacity. That is, common 55 Ah batteries for cars need to be charged with a current of no more than 5.5 amperes. The exception is the Boost mode mentioned above. But with him you need to know when to stop. Boost charge current should not exceed 30 percent of standard value. For the same 55 Ah battery, this maximum current in Boost mode should not be higher than 5.5 + 5.5 * 0.3 = 7.15 amperes.

Remember to charge with high current only in unusual situations where an urgent boost charge is required. This mode cannot be used permanently, as it reduces the battery life.


In this case, it is better to choose a starting-charger for a car battery with a margin for the output current, so that every time it did not work at the limit of its capabilities.

Ideally, the charger should be able to manually adjust the current. All other things being equal, we advise you to choose just such memory. Then, if necessary, it will be possible to charge the battery at low current. After all, most chargers automatically select the current themselves. But for a more complete and high-quality charging, it is better to conduct it with a low current at a constant voltage. It will take longer, but much better. If the battery is charged in this mode, then its plates will be much less susceptible to sulfation. Therefore, we can say with confidence that a charger with regulation of the charge current is the right choice.

We tested eight devices taken for the test at two temperatures: -10 and +20 ºС. We must say right away that you should not believe the statements of individual manufacturers about performance in more severe frosts. Firstly, the intensity of the charging process in the cold drops very strongly: at -25 ºС the charging current of the 55th battery will be only 4–6% of the indicator at plus twenty-five. And attempts to raise the charge voltage are fraught with destruction of the active mass and corrosion of down conductors. Secondly, at lower temperatures, the insulation of the power wires of the presented devices hardens and breaks. Thirdly ... However, two reasons are quite enough.

The battery does not produce electricity, it only stores it and then gives it away. The battery is charged from the car's electric generator, but full charging is not achieved, therefore, after some time, the battery loses its charge, requiring the connection of external devices. When the temperature is above zero, the engine is able to start from a half-charged battery, but in winter the chances of starting are significantly reduced if the battery is not fully charged. Chargers and starters for batteries are:

  1. Pulse. The advantages of devices of this variety are compactness and low weight as well. They are more convenient to use, at a higher cost than transformer chargers, but later the purchase pays off. The principle of operation of pulsed devices is based on the creation of high-frequency currents, for which large dimensions are unnecessary.
  2. Transformer devices are much more voluminous and it is inconvenient to have such a device with you at all times, they are usually used for stationary battery maintenance. The action of the device is to reduce the voltage by means of a standard conversion. Transformer chargers are considered reliable, easy to repair, but heavy.

Top 10 inverter chargers

Inverter (pulse) chargers are car chargers that restore the battery capacity in a fully automatic mode. This opportunity is provided by an intelligent microcontroller that can analyze all the most important parameters of a rechargeable battery and, depending on these indicators, independently select the required amperage and voltage at any given time. The user is not required to enter or change its settings during the operation of the device, while the inverter charger provides the most gentle charging conditions for the battery, which prolongs its service life. A distinctive feature of such devices is high functionality, provided by a large number of pre-configured parameters, as well as a high level of security. The main advantage of inverter devices is the protection of the battery from overcharging, which some types of auto-accumulators do not like very much.

Pulse charging CTEK MXS 25 can only work with 12-volt batteries, but it supports batteries in a very wide range of capacities (40-500 Ah) at a maximum charge current of 25 A.

Despite such impressive parameters, the device is lightweight (less than 2 kg) and (235x65x130 mm). It is able to work with all types of lead-acid batteries (WET, MF), as well as with gel and AGM batteries.

MXS 25, like the previous model, is a multifunctional device with support for 8 modes, including Supply, which allows you to use the charger as a power source and disconnect the battery while maintaining the basic settings.

Among the important functions, it is worth noting the ability to diagnose a battery for its ability to accept a charge, as well as to hold it, the possibility of desulfation of plates, detailed prevention of battery.

Top 5 transformer chargers

The main difference between classic transformer charging and inverter analogs is the absence of a microcontroller. In other words, the process of restoring the battery capacity does not take place automatically. This means that the car owner must monitor the ammeter to stop the process as it completes. Transformer devices can have a current charge regulator, while all of them are characterized by large weight and dimensions, which is due to the use of a transformer-type current converter. Despite a number of the aforementioned disadvantages, this type of charging is still very popular. The reason is simple - low cost, simplicity and reliability of the design, high maintainability.
